American Viticultural Areas (AVA) Project

The American Viticultural Areas (AVA) Project is an open-licensed, community-contributed spatial dataset of the American Viticultural Areas boundaries, maintained by UC Davis DataLab and Library, with significant contributions from UCSB Library and Virginia Tech.
